- Screen Size: 19-inches
- Resolution: 1440 pixels x 900 pixels
- Brightness: 300 cd/m2
- Contrast Ratio: 1000:1 (DC 3000:1)
- Response time: 2ms (GTG)
- Viewing Angle: 160 degrees horizontal and vertical
- Signal input: Video Signal Analog RGB, Digital Sync. Signal Separate H/V, Composite , SOG Connectors 15pin D-sub, DVI-D
- In-use power consumption: 42 watts (maximum)
- Stand-by power consumption (DPMS): Less than 1 watt
- Dimensions:
- 17.7 in. x 14.7 in. x 7.8 in.

On a scale of one to 10, I'd give the Samsung 932BW a 7.5; but it could be that my graphics card needs upgrading to power the monitor. Video is fair. Text clarity is lacking, characters appear almost out-of-focus with some characters nearly illegible: n tends to appear as r; l, i and other stokes fade out.Generally an adequate monitor, acceptable when cost is a strong factor and resolution not-quite-as-good as higher priced models is all right.Would recommend it to a friend only with cautions to not expect top-of-the-line results. Would be a good standby to have in case a primary monitor goes down. I did not try any games on it.
